Requirements
  • At least 5 years of experience in platform engineering, cloud engineering, DevOps, software engineering, data engineering, systems integration, or related technical roles.
  • Hands-on experience designing and deploying cloud-native applications and services on AWS, Microsoft Azure, and/or Google Cloud Platform.
  • Strong experience with continuous integration and continuous delivery, Git-based workflows, automated testing, infrastructure as code, and production release processes.
  • Experience with containerization and orchestration technologies such as Docker, Kubernetes, serverless services, or comparable cloud-native platforms.
  • Proficiency in Python, JavaScript/TypeScript, Java, Go, Bash, or similar programming and scripting languages.
  • Experience designing and consuming REST APIs, integrating enterprise applications, and implementing authentication and authorization patterns.
  • Hands-on experience with large-language-model applications, generative AI services, AI/ML platforms, retrieval-augmented generation systems, AI workflow automation, or related technologies.
  • Familiarity with prompt and context engineering, token management, embeddings, vector search, retrieval-augmented generation, structured outputs, tool use or function calling, evaluations, and model monitoring.
  • Experience with observability tools and practices, including logging, metrics, tracing, alerting, and incident management.
  • Strong knowledge of cloud security, identity and access management, secrets management, network security, and secure software-development practices.
  • Experience working with relational databases, NoSQL databases, data warehouses, object storage, search platforms, or vector databases.
  • Strong problem-solving, troubleshooting, communication, and documentation skills.
  • Ability to work effectively in a fast-paced, collaborative, customer-oriented environment.
  • A b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, Information Systems, Data Science, or a related technical discipline, with equivalent relevant professional experience considered.
Responsibilities
  • Design, build, deploy, and maintain scalable platform capabilities supporting enterprise AI, machine learning, large-language-model, retrieval-augmented-generation, and agentic AI applications.
  • Create reusable reference architectures, infrastructure patterns, deployment templates, integration components, and engineering standards for the AI Foundry.
  • Build platform capabilities that enable AI applications to securely connect to enterprise data, APIs, workflow systems, and authorized tools.
  • Partner with AI Architects and Forward Deployed AI Engineers to translate client needs into reliable, supportable technical platform designs.
  • Support the technical evolution of the NewRocket Intelligence Platform, Data Intelligence Platform, Value Realization Dashboard, Agent Packs, and reusable AI accelerators.
  • Evaluate and recommend cloud, data, AI, observability, orchestration, and security technologies that improve delivery speed, quality, scalability, and cost efficiency.
  • Build and maintain secure, reusable integrations with the Anthropic API, Claude models, and other approved AI services.
  • Enable standardized patterns for authentication, model access, prompt and context management, structured outputs, tool use, logging, error handling, and rate-limit management.
  • Support Claude-based enterprise use cases involving document analysis, knowledge assistance, workflow automation, agentic task execution, summarization, classification, and decision support.
  • Develop technical patterns for long-context workflows, document processing, retrieval-augmented generation, structured data extraction, and model-driven automation.
  • Support secure Model Context Protocol and comparable tool-integration patterns for approved enterprise systems and data.
  • Establish and operate continuous integration and continuous delivery pipelines for AI applications, model configurations, prompts, evaluation assets, infrastructure, and integration services.
  • Implement versioning, testing, release management, rollback, and change-control practices for AI solutions.
  • Build and maintain large-language-model operations and machine-learning operations capabilities, including configuration management, evaluation pipelines, deployment automation, monitoring, and lifecycle management.
  • Develop automated evaluation and regression-testing frameworks to measure AI quality before and after releases.
  • Support production operations for AI services, including incident response, troubleshooting, root-cause analysis, capacity planning, and service-level monitoring.
  • Define and monitor operational metrics such as availability, latency, throughput, token consumption, model cost, tool-call success rates, task-completion rates, and error rates.
  • Improve platform reliability, performance, resilience, and cost efficiency through automation, tuning, and operational improvements.
  • Design and manage cloud infrastructure across AWS, Microsoft Azure, Google Cloud Platform, or client-approved environments.
  • Build and maintain infrastructure using infrastructure-as-code tools such as Terraform, CloudFormation, Bicep, Pulumi, or comparable technologies.
  • Implement containerized application and AI-service deployments using Docker, Kubernetes, serverless services, and cloud-native application patterns.
  • Develop secure continuous integration and continuous delivery workflows using Git-based source control, automated testing, artifact management, secrets management, and policy controls.
  • Implement identity, access, and authentication patterns, including role-based access control, least-privilege access, API security, service accounts, and credential rotation.
  • Partner with security, compliance, and client teams to align AI platforms with enterprise security, privacy, regulatory, and data-residency requirements.
  • Implement logging, monitoring, auditing, vulnerability management, disaster recovery, and business continuity practices for production AI services.
  • Build and support secure data-ingestion, transformation, indexing, and retrieval pipelines for enterprise AI applications.
  • Design retrieval-augmented-generation platform patterns involving document ingestion, parsing, chunking, metadata enrichment, embeddings, vector stores, hybrid search, retrieval, reranking, and source attribution.
  • Integrate AI applications with structured and unstructured enterprise data sources, including databases, data warehouses, document repositories, knowledge bases, ServiceNow, and third-party SaaS platforms.
  • Work with data engineers to establish data-quality, lineage, cataloging, permissions, retention, and governance practices supporting trustworthy AI.
  • Enable data-access controls so AI solutions retrieve and process only data authorized for the requesting user or service.
  • Implement technical controls supporting responsible, secure, and governable AI deployments.
  • Build safeguards for sensitive-data handling, data masking, content filtering, prompt injection, unsafe tool use, unauthorized access, and unintended agent behavior.
  • Enable grounding, output validation, source attribution, confidence thresholds, fallback behavior, approval gates, and human-in-the-loop workflows.
  • Implement AI observability and tracing across prompts, model calls, retrieval pipelines, tool execution, workflow outcomes, latency, errors, costs, and user feedback.
  • Partner with AI Architects and governance stakeholders to document platform standards, risk controls, operating procedures, and solution limitations.
  • Support auditability and compliance through logging, retention, access reviews, and operational documentation.
  • Build and maintain integration patterns between AI platforms, ServiceNow, enterprise APIs, identity providers, workflow tools, collaboration platforms, and line-of-business systems.
  • Support ServiceNow AI and workflow experiences, including IntegrationHub, Flow Designer, Virtual Agent, Now Assist, AI Agents, APIs, and knowledge-management capabilities.
  • Develop secure APIs, middleware services, event-driven integrations, and automation components supporting AI-enabled workflows.
  • Collaborate with Forward Deployed AI Engineers to troubleshoot complex client integrations and transition successful engagement solutions into reusable platform components.
  • Work closely with AI Architects, AI/ML Engineers, Data Engineers, Product Engineering, ServiceNow developers, Business Process Consultants, and client technology teams.
  • Provide technical guidance on AI platform engineering, cloud architecture, DevOps, large-language-model operations, data integration, performance, and security best practices.
  • Contribute to internal playbooks, runbooks, reference architectures, technical documentation, reusable modules, and knowledge-sharing sessions.
  • Identify recurring client requirements and convert them into scalable, productized platform features and accelerators.
  • Participate in technical discovery, architecture reviews, demos, implementation planning, and customer workshops as needed.

NewRocket provides digital transformation solutions on the ServiceNow platform, building tailored portals, intranets, and mobile apps to streamline workflows and boost user engagement. It delivers end-to-end digital workflow solutions by automating tasks, integrating processes, and defining API interfaces for external systems. It differentiates itself through deep ServiceNow expertise and customized, ongoing support for a global client base that includes energy providers and municipal services. Its goal is to help organizations improve efficiency and customer satisfaction by modernizing workflows and interfaces.

NewRocket launches Maestro to orchestrate AI with ServiceNow AI Control Tower

NewRocket has launched Maestro, an AI orchestration and governance offering that combines ServiceNow AI Control Tower with expert-led services to help enterprises coordinate, scale and measure AI initiatives. The offering addresses the challenge of turning AI investment into measurable business value. Maestro provides centralised AI inventory, structured lifecycle orchestration, embedded governance and risk controls aligned with frameworks including the EU AI Act and NIST AI RMF, and value tracking against business KPIs. The platform aims to give organisations visibility across their AI landscape whilst maintaining compliance and control. The offering is delivered through advisory, implementation and managed services, with capabilities spanning AI enterprise management, lifecycle workflows, governance controls and maturity-based engagement. Maestro offers multiple entry points, allowing organisations to begin at their current AI maturity level.

NewRocket joins Anthropic's Claude Partner Network with enterprise AI training and deployment services

NewRocket, an AI-first technology services provider, has joined Anthropic's Claude Partner Network as a launch Select partner and introduced new enterprise offerings for Claude deployment. The company is launching three service lines: Claude training and enablement programmes, adoption services for change management and governance, and forward-deployed "Claude Squads". Claude Squads embed AI engineers, solution architects and workflow experts directly with client teams to deliver high-impact AI initiatives focused on business value realisation. NewRocket positions itself as a services partner connecting Anthropic and ServiceNow, using Claude's AI capabilities with ServiceNow as the control plane for orchestration and governance. The offerings aim to address common enterprise AI challenges including complexity, slow time-to-value and fragmented tools.
